The trail was historically utilized as a 'gold delivery' route during the Japanese colonial period for transporting ore and supplies.
Parts of the trail surface retain original stone paving techniques designed for transport rather than recreation.
The route sits within the geologically significant area of the Jinguashi gold deposit, known for its distinct enargite and pyrite mineralogy.
The trail's vegetation is dominated by silvergrass, which turns golden during the autumn blooming season.
The pathway provides a direct sightline to the chimney remnants of the former Jinguashi copper smelting plant.
The Diaoshan Historic Trail is a rugged mountain path in Ruifang District that historically served as a critical transport route for the region's gold and coal mining industry. The trail connects the historic Gold Ecological Park area to the mountain ridgelines, offering panoramic views of the Teapot Mountain and the Pacific coastline. It features stone-paved segments reminiscent of its 19th-century origins, though much of the path has been reclaimed by secondary forest and silvergrass. Hikers ascend along the mountain spine, where elevation changes provide expansive vistas of the Keelung North Coast. The trail is known for its exposure to high winds and varying weather conditions typical of the New Taipei mountain ranges. It serves as a connector between the mining heritage sites of Jinguashi and the surrounding natural ridgelines.

Bring a windproof jacket as the ridgeline is frequently exposed to strong coastal gusts.
Carry at least one liter of water, as there are no natural water sources or facilities along the trail.
Use trekking poles to assist with balance on the uneven, centuries-old stone steps.
Do not attempt this hike during heavy rain or typhoons, as the stone steps become extremely slick and the ridgeline poses a lightning hazard.
Practice 'Leave No Trace' principles; stay on marked paths to prevent erosion of the historic stone foundations.
